I once had a roommate who didn't pay rent for three months and then barricaded himself inside my house when I asked him to move out. If you've ever had roomies, then you likely have a few tales like this, and you're not alone. These roommate horror stories on Twitter will definitely keep you up at night wondering what the hell is wrong with people. Because it's not you — it's them. Obviously.

With a decent apartment costing eleventy million dollars and jobs paying far less than you deserve, roommates are pretty much a necessity. After a murderous roommate horror story came out this week in New York magazine, some people are rethinking that whole roommate thing. But, unfortunately, you don't always have a choice. In Los Angeles, the situation has become so dire that people are posting ads to share bedrooms, to rent out vans and RVs as faux tiny houses, and to couch surf. The housing struggle is real, and finding a good place to live with people who share your sensibilities can be challenging AF.

Roommate drama is definitely a common topic among my friends. Luckily me and my current roomie get on like peas and carrots. Because we've both had enough bad roommates to last a lifetime, we made sure we were on the same page before we moved in together. Whether you're in roomie hell or cohabitation heaven, most of us have been there, and we have the receipts to prove it.
